The original ride-on platform! The Lascal Maxi BuggyBoard® provides a safe and practical solution for tired toddlers aged 2 – 6 (up to 22kg), offering secure attachment to most pushchairs and ensuring a comfortable ride on any terrain – no need for a double buggy!
- Compatible with the Saddle, if your child wants the option for a seat.
- Its patented easy-fit connection system securely fits 99% of pushchairs.
- An innovative suspension system with larger durable wheels ensures a comfortable ride around corners, over kerbs and through doorways.
- Features include a large anti-slip surface, side protection, and reflective decals for added safety in crowded or high traffic areas.
- Quick & easy solution for when not in use; the Strap & Hook to clip the board up, out of the way.
- SGS tested and approved, meeting European and US safety standards
- Awarded the Project Baby Silver Award for 'Best Pram Accessory', providing a convenient lift for toddlers without the need for a
double buggy.
Dimensions:
Platform Size - 44.5cm W x 20.5cm D x 15.5cm H
Pushchair Fittings (Width) - 31-54cm

Extended Rear Facing
Extended rear facing (ERF) car seats are becoming more popular after the safety benefits were realised in Sweden by child safety experts to keep children travelling as safely as possible on the road and from that developed the Swedish Plus Test which subjects seats entered for the test through harsher crash testing than standardised testing does. Newborn car seats are always rear facing and there’s no reason to change that for the toddler stage. Rear facing child seats are safer and more comfortable than forward facing equivalents and all car seat suppliers have ERF options to choose from within their ranges.
Children should be rear facing for as long as possible and the best type of seat will be the one most suited to their weight and height so it will vary from child to child. Seeking the advice from a car seat specialist to check it fits your car and child will ensure you get the safest seat and get best value for money to ensure your child can stay rear facing from ages birth to 6 (approx).
